Are you competing in the 2026 National Speech & Debate Tournament? If so, you and your family are invited to step onto VCU's campus while you're in Richmond for a one-of-a-kind walking tour, designed just for you. Three departure times are available for tours on Thursday, June 18, 2026.

An urban campus unlike any other

Virginia Commonwealth University sits right in the heart of Richmond, and these tours are built especially for students and families attending the National Speech & Debate Tournament.

Join a one-hour walking tour through our vibrant Monroe Park campus, kicking off from VCU's University Student Commons  — a short walk from the Altria Theater where tournament finals will take place. You'll experience the energy of student life, see popular spots and get a real feel for what makes VCU uncommon.

Complimentary parking will be available at the West Main Street Deck at 801 W. Main Street. VCU staff will validate parking for tour participants.

Please note, tours are mostly outdoors and do not include residence hall interiors. Guests under the age of 18 must be accompanied by an adult to participate in Office of Admissions-led events and/or tours.
